FERD40U50C Field effect rectifier Datasheet - production data Description $ This dual rectifier is based on a proprietary technology that achieved the best in class VF/IR for a given silicon surface. . $ Packaged in TO-220FPAB, this device is intended to be used in rectification and freewheeling operations in switch-mode power supplies. Features • ST advanced rectifier process Symbol Value IF(AV) 2 x 20 A VRRM 50 V Tj (max) +175 °C VF(typ) 0.43 V • Stable leakage current over reverse voltage • Reduced leakage current • Low forward voltage drop • High frequency operation • Insulated package: TO-220FPAB – Insulating voltage: 2000 VRMS sine June 2015 This is information on a product in full production.
